MBTA Bus, Pedestrian, 2 Cars, Involved In Roslindale Crash
Four people were sent to the hospital, including a man who was standing at a bus stop.
ROSLINDALE, MA — A pedestrian was hit by a vehicle during a crash that involved two cars and an MBTA bus. Four people, including the pedestrian were taken to the hospital with non-life threatening injuries, according to Boston Fire Department officials.
Just before 1 p.m. Thursday emergency responders were called to the intersection of Hyde Park Ave. and Canterbury Street. The MBTA transit police are investigating.
No further details were immediately available.
